There are three major kinds of rowing machines that include air rowers, water rowers, and magnetic rowers. Air rowers use the power of a fan to generate resistance, while water rowers make use of paddles in a pool of water to create resistance magnetic rowers utilize magnets to generate resistance. Each type of rowing machine has its own advantages and disadvantages. Air rowers are most affordableoption, but they're also more likely to be noisy and create a lot of vibration. Water rowers are quieter alternative, however they're more expensive. The magnetic rowers are in the middle in terms of price, but they give a smooth and easy rowing that's comfortable for joints.
